The P7 series introduces the Precision Bass to Sire's bass lineup, delivering the highest possible quality while maintaining the exceptional value Sire is known for. Crafted with premium finishes and woods, ensuring the bass looks perfect.
- Precision Bass body shape
- Marcus Miller Heritage-3 preamp
- Marcus Miller Super-PJ Revolution pickups
Marcus Miller and Sire want everyone to enjoy and play music. To make this happen, they have been on a mission for the past few years to build a high-quality bass at an incredible price, making it accessible to everyone. The result is a line of Marcus Miller bass models that deliver amazing sound and a fantastic look.
- American alder body
- One-piece Canadian maple neck
- Double-action carbon truss rod (5-string models)
- Palisander fingerboard
- Ivory binding
- Active circuitry (18V)
- Mini switch for active/passive mode
- 3-band EQ control
- Additional mid-range control
- Rounded fingerboard edges
- Marcus Miller Heavy Mass bridge
- Optional through-body stringing
- Sire Premium open tuning machines
- Bone nut
- 'Block' inlays
- Finish: Black
